root@cnicfhnui-VirtualBox:/S3C2440/u-boot-2015.04# make menuconfig
HOSTCC scripts/kconfig/mconf.o
In file included from scripts/kconfig/mconf.c:23:0:
scripts/kconfig/lxdialog/dialog.h:38:20: 致命错误: curses.h:没有那个文件或目录
编译中断。
make[1]: *** [scripts/kconfig/mconf.o] 错误 1
make: *** [menuconfig] 错误 2
解决:安装libncurses5-dev
sudo apt-get update
sudo apt-get install libncurses5-dev
关键字:arm-linux-gcc 移植 u-boot2015.04
引用地址:
arm-linux-gcc 移植u-boot2015.04时make menuconfig 错误
推荐阅读最新更新时间:2024-03-16 15:03
AM3D 音频增强软件移植至Tensilica HiFi音频DSP
美国加州SANTA CLARA和丹麦AALBORG-2013年3月11日-Tensilica和AM3D A/S今日联合宣布双方拓展合作,将AM3D的音频增强产品移植至Tensilica的HiFi音频DSP系列。这将显著提升移动电话、车载娱乐、家庭娱乐系统和个人电脑的音频体验。 AM3D的低音增强和均衡变换器可以显著提升音频性能,而其虚拟环绕音效,则通过创建良好的声像延展了物理扬声器。该解决方案完全基于软件实现,所有功能都占用极低的内存和CPU性能。 Tensilica多媒体市场高级总监Larry Przywara表示:“许多客户都在寻找高级音频增强解决方案。AM3D显著提升了自然音色与低音音效,该优化的功能套件不久即将面世。”
[嵌入式]
U-Boot移植(19)新移植到ylp2410上u-boot的功能
新u-boot-1.1.6-new的功能: 1、同时支持S3C2410和S3C2440 2、支持串口xmodem协议 3、支持USB下载,可以在PC上使用dnw传数据 4、支持网卡芯片dm9000aep 5、支持NAND Flash读写 6、支持从Nor/Nand Flash启动 7、支持烧写yaffs文件系统映象 8、可以直接下载到内存运行 9、支持CFI、Jedec接口的Nor Flash 10、把环境参数保存在nand flash中 11、u-boot把分区设为: define MTDPARTS_DEFAULT mtdparts=nandflash0:256k@0(bootloader), 12
[单片机]
stm32f103C8T6移植enc28j60+UIP1.0
移植环境(蓝色粗体字为特别注意内容) 1,开发板:STM32F103C8T6最小系统开发板。 2,开发环境:Keil uv5 3,参考文献:https://blog.csdn.net/wzs298/article/details/12228481 移植ENC28J60这个网络模块可谓是困难重重啊,。。。。。找了很多个例子都没有成功的,只能说很坑很坑,我不知道网上为什么那么多人抄袭,,没有经过自己验证就copy出来。。。。捣鼓了一天终于把这个坑爹的模块搞定了,,,, 先来贴一张图片: 本例程移植uIP-1.0协议栈,演示开发板和PC间的TCP通信。自定义了一个简单的应用层 通信协议。本例程实现的功能有: (1)通过
[单片机]
uC/OS-II在EP7312上的移植
摘要:首先介绍μC/OS-II操作系统的特点,重点分析μC/OS-II在EP7312上的移植方法,介绍μC/OS-II在EP7312中的开发过程。
关键词:嵌入式操作系统 μC/OS-II EP7312
引 言
随着Internet和后PC时代的到来,嵌入式系统的应用愈来愈广泛,嵌入式产品在人们的生活中无处不在。今天,嵌入式系统带来的工业年产值已超过1万亿美元,已经在IT产业中占有很大的比重。
通常,应用程序对嵌入式软件的基本要求是体积小、执行速度快、具有较好的裁减性和可移植性。嵌入式软件的灵魂是嵌入式操作系统。在特定的操作系统之上开发应用软件,可以让程序开发人员屏蔽掉很多低层硬件细节,使得应用程序调试方便、移植简
[嵌入式]
ucos-ii移植到ARM上的一个简单例子mini2440
基于mini2440的一个简单移植程序led.c #include config.h #define LED1 (0 5) //定义LED,GPB5 #define TaskStkLength 64 //定义堆栈长度 OS_STK TaskLEDStk ; //定义任务LED的堆栈 void TaskLED(void *pdata); //声明任务LED int Main(void) //ADS中不能写成main(void),一定大写 { TargetInit(); //目标板初始化 OSInit(); //uC/OS-II初始化 OSTimeSet(
[单片机]
LCD驱动移植之背光控制
移植环境 BootLoader:u-boot-1.1.6 kernel:linux-2.6.30.4 CPU:s3c2440 开发板:TQ2440 移植步骤 控制 LCD 背光的开关对于TQ2440 开发板来讲,就是控制S3C2440 的 LCD 控制的LCD_PWREN 脚,根据 S3C2440 的datasheet,可以知道在 LCDCON5 寄存器的 PWREN 位是控制 LCD 是否输出的,当为 0 时 LCD 不输出,此时 LCD_PWREN 脚为低,就会关闭 LCD 的背光;当为 1 时 LCD 输出,此时 LCD_PWREN 脚为高,开启 LCD 的背光。 1、编写LCD背光驱动 对于 Linux
[单片机]
OpenCV2.0.0移植到ARM9(三)(JZ2440----S3c2440)
在前面已经交叉编译生成了OpenCV的库,libjpeg相关的库。下面尝试OpenCV应用程序编写与交叉编译。 1、opencv测试程序 test.cpp程序代码: #include stdio.h #include highgui.h #include imgproc.h int main(int argc,char *argv ) { IplImage* img = cvLoadImage( abc.jpg ); cvNamedWindow( Example1 , CV_WINDOW_AUTOSIZE); cvShowImage( Example1 , img); cvWaitKey(
[单片机]
μC/GUI在MSGl9264液晶上的移植
介绍在MSP430F149单片机上移植,μC/CUI到MSCl9264液晶的过程, 详细阐述了,μC/GUI移植的原理以及在移植中应注意的事项。 μC/GUI是美国Micrium公司出品的一款针对嵌入式系统的优秀图形软件。与μC/OS一样,μC/GUI具有源码公开、可移植、可裁减、稳定性和可靠性高的特点 。采用μC/GUI,开发人员可以很方便地在液晶上显示文本、曲线、图形以及各种窗口对象如按钮、编辑框、滑动条等,可完全产生类似于Windows的显示效果。另外,μC/GUI提供了在VC下的仿真库,这使得用户完全可以在Windows下仿真μC/GUI的各种效果。 采用μC/GUI,可以大大降低嵌入式系统中显示设计的难度,但μC
[单片机]